Selecting the Right Protection for the Job



Not all floor protection solutions are suitable for every job. Choosing the right one depends on your flooring and the intensity of the work.




  • Adhesive carpet film adheres lightly to carpet fibers without causing damage, guarding against dirt.

  • For hard floors, rigid sheets like Correx or impact panels offer strong impact resistance, and are easy to handle.

  • In wet areas, anti-slip coverings provide added safety for both crew and clients.



These products are available in multiple configurations, making them perfect for everything from small home projects to large-scale commercial builds.
